The average reading speed of most English-speaking adults is around 200 … Speaking rate is often expressed in words per minute (wpm). To calculate this value, you’ll need to record yourself talking for a few minutes and then add up the number of words in your speech. Divide the total number of words by the number of minutes your speech took. You can record yourself with your … Ver mais The average speaking rate changes dramatically for the purpose of your speech. To read at a rate of 150 words per minute, you should finish the passage in 1 minute, 20 seconds. 200 words per minute should, obviously, take you one minute, and a rate of 250 words per minute should take you about 48 seconds. the courtyards at weddington roadWebSlow speechis usually regarded as less than 110 wpm, or words per minute. Conversational speechgenerally falls between 120 wpm at the slow end, to 160 - 200 wpm in the fast range.
